Christopher Sean is an American actor best known for his performance as Paul Narita on NBC’s long-running soap opera Days of Our Lives.
Hailing from Washington, Sean was raised in California where he learnt to become comfortable in front of the camera after spending much of his childhood recording videos for his father, who was in the Navy, whenever he was stationed away from home. Sean began his career as a model after being discovered while he was working at Six Flags Hurricane Harbor. He first gained major recognition when he was crowned Mr. Asia USA at the 2007 pageant; with his winnings including $1,500 and an acting class at the Michael John Studio, a new career was in Sean’s sights.
Despite struggling early on to land roles due to his mixed ethnicity, Sean has gone on to win several major roles after making his debut in a 2010 episode of The Bold and the Beautiful. Sean’s big break came when he was cast as Bing Lee in the Emmy-winning The Lizzie Bennet Diaries, which was quickly followed by major roles as Gabriel Waincroft in Hawaii Five-0 and Paul Narita in Days of Our Lives. Additional credits include The Mindy Project, The Bay, Home is Where the Killer Is, You and Young American Dream.
As a voice actor, Sean landed the role of the main character Kazuda Xiono in animated series Star Wars Resistance, to great critical acclaim. He has also leant his voice to characters in popular video games Epic Seven, Fallout 76, Time to Hunt, Ghost of Tsushima and Marvel’s Avengers. Sean’s extensive fanbase is currently excited about the upcoming release of the highly-anticipated Gotham Knights, for which Sean will voice Dick Grayson, and his superhero alter-ego Nightwing.
